What they do
A Shipping or Receiving Clerk tracks all incoming and/or outgoing shipments at a company facility and checks that shipment orders are filled correctly. Uses scanning equipment to track inventory. Works in receiving to check shipments that are primarily production materials or company supplies, or checks outgoing shipments of finished products.

Job Description
Performs shipping and receiving activities to support daily logistics operations within established procedures. Handles standard material movements, verifies incoming and outgoing shipments, and maintains accurate records of inventory transactions. Works with moderate supervision and resolves routine issues related to shipment accuracy, documentation, and material handling by applying known procedures. Monitors quality and accuracy of work, escalates issues outside of standard processes, and supports efficient flow of materials to meet operational needs.
JOB DUTIES
Executes shipping and receiving tasks according to established procedures and work instructions. Verifies quantities, part numbers, and shipment documents for incoming and outgoing materials. Prepares materials for shipment, including labeling, packaging, and updating required records. Receives, inspects, and routes materials to the appropriate location or department. Updates inventory or shipping system records to maintain accurate transaction data. Identifies routine shipment or documentation issues and resolves them using standard procedures. Communicates with internal team members to coordinate daily material flow and delivery timing.
